This standard is the most prominent 2021 revision under the "MS" (Malaysian Standard) prefix. It focuses on the chemical analysis of raw rubber.
Purpose: It specifies methods for determining volatile-matter content in raw rubbers using either a hot mill or an oven .
Scope: It applies to "R" group rubbers (those with unsaturated carbon chains), including natural and synthetic rubbers derived from di-olefins . Key Methods:
Hot-mill method: Generally faster but not applicable to natural rubber or rubbers that are difficult to handle on a mill.
Oven method: Considered the reference method (Procedure A) in cases of dispute .

If you are looking for manufacturing tolerances, "MS81" is a common prefix for internal engineering standards used by Mitsubishi Motors Corporation (MMC).
MS81-2029: This standard defines General Dimension Tolerances for parts produced via press working (sheet metal) .
Permissible Deviations: It specifies the allowed deviations for dimensions like cut width and cut length when no specific tolerance is indicated on a drawing .

The MS 812:2021 (also referred to in technical documentation as MSF1-2021E) is an engineering standard primarily used by the Mitsubishi Fuso Truck and Bus Corporation (MFTBC) to define general tolerances for machining cut dimensions. Overview of MS 812:2021
This standard is designed to streamline the engineering and manufacturing process by simplifying drawing indications. Instead of specifying individual tolerances for every single dimension on a technical drawing, engineers can refer to this standard to establish uniform acceptable deviations for parts produced by metal removal processes. Key Scopes and Applications
The standard applies to dimensions that lack specific individual tolerance indications, including:
Linear Dimensions: External and internal dimensions, diameters, radii, distances, and step dimensions. Corner Features: Radii and chamfer dimensions of corners.
Angular Dimensions: Machined angles, including those not explicitly indicated in a drawing.
Assembled Parts: Linear and angular dimensions resulting from the machining of pre-assembled components. Importance in Industry
By utilizing a standardized general tolerance like MS 812:2021, manufacturers ensure consistency across different production facilities and suppliers. It reduces the complexity of technical drawings, minimizes the risk of misinterpretation, and ensures that parts meet functional requirements while maintaining cost-effective manufacturing tolerances.
